Requirements
It is important to be aware that your mercedes keys replacement car key replacement needs you to meet certain conditions. These requirements include presenting a valid ID or passport along with evidence of ownership of the vehicle.
Another requirement is that the replacement key be linked to the vehicle's immobilizer system. A transponder is used for this. A transponder is a small chip that transmits a code to identify the key when it is near the ignition. This can prevent the theft of the key or its use in another vehicle.
A local Mercedes dealership will be in a position to synchronize the replacement key to the immobilizer. They will have the tools necessary to synchronize your replacement key to your vehicle's systems. They also can provide an extra key if you don't have your original one.
